The Caricature Carvers of America is an organization of nationally recognized carvers, all with diverse caricature carving styles, dedicated to the promotion of their favorite craft. Established in 1990, this selective 25-seat organization continues to elevate and promote the art of caricature carving today. This book, Caricature Carvers Showcase , features some of America's finest caricature carvers and celebrates their talents. Perusing the guide's biographies and photos of America's top caricature carvers, you'll become acquainted with 30 members, both active and emeritus, such as Marv Kaisersatt, Eldon Humphreys, Peter Ortel, and Pete LeClair. Each profile includes original patterns viewed from different angles, complete with techniques and painting and finishing tips—but these patterns aren't for beginners! CCA members produce elevated art and their patterns will challenge you to grow and stretch your caricature carving skills. Discover 50 original patterns along with biographies of members of the Caricature Carvers of America. Although they've never made claims of being "the best," the members of CCA have garnered hundreds of "Best of Show" and First Place awards, taught countless seminars, and published over 100 popular books about caricature carving. Review: The second best caricature carving book out there - When I decided to pick up a caricature carving book I was thrilled by the number of titles available. This excitement soon turned to confusion as I tried to decide which books to add to my cart and which to leave on the desertcart.com shelf. A large part of the problem was that most of the books within the field of caricature carving seemed to carry a 4 or 5 star rating which prevented me from enacting Rule No.1 of my desertcart RULE OF PURCHASE which states: All things being equal, purchase the item with the highest customer rating. So with Rule No.1 nullified I found myself pouring over page after page of LOOK INSIDE in an attempt to narrow down my choices. Unfortunately, that wasn't much help either so I took the unprecedented step of just buying EVERY caricature carving book I could find that carried a 4 or 5 star rating. 10 days and 5 titles later I'm ready to offer you my feedback, based on a few essential criteria, in the hopes that I'll save you both the time and the money I invested. Before I get to my ratings, let me run down the criteria I used to make my assessments: 1) Larger books with good color photography trump smaller books with black & white photography. 2) Books that provide step-by-step instruction are far superior than photographic collections of finished projects. 3) Books that provide complete instruction, from wood selection to painting techniques, are better than books offering scant or piecemeal instruction. 4) Because individual carvers have unique styles, I found that the books that contained the works of numerous carvers were far more instructional than those containing the works of just one carver. With those 4 criteria in mind, my top 5 caricature carving books are: 1) Caricature Carving: Expert Techniques & 30 All-Time Favorite Projects ~ The BEST of the bunch. Wonderful photographs outlining the steps required to carve the works of numerous different artists. Instructions run from wood selection all the way to paint selection with everything in between including which tools to use. If you have a limited budget or you just want to own one caricature carving book then this is the one for you. 5 STARS 2) Caricature Carvers Showcase ~ Unlike the #1 selection, this title does not include ANY step-by-step instructions on carving so if you're looking for an instructional guide, this ISN'T it. So why do I rate it so highly? Because it contains wonderful color photographs of the work of 50 different carvers; and while it's a mystery HOW the artists created their work, you can't help but shake your head in amazement at the finished product. 4½ STARS 3) Whittling Little Folk ~ A smaller text from a single artist. The work here is more basic than most caricature carvers which is not necessarily a bad thing for the novice carvers among us. Good step-by-step color photography. The first 2 projects are covered in detail from wood selection to final coat of paint. The final 15 or so projects are described in far less detail. Not as flashy as some of the other titles, but this one grew on me and was actually the source book for my very first carving effort. 4 STARS 4) Caricature Carving from Head to Toe ~ A decent text that contains thorough, step-by-step instructions and photographs leading to the creation of an elderly gentleman caricature. The book contains the work of just one artist so you'll garner just one perspective which I think is a major limitation. A gallery of the artists work rounds out the text, and while his work is of the highest quality it's not as varied as that of a collection of artists. 3 STARS 5) Carving the Little Guys ~ With just 31 pages this is more of a pamphlet than a book. The text is again the work of a single artist who's forte appears to be basic caricatures. Good photographs instruct the reader in the production of just a single, basic caricature (is the black thing under his nose a tongue or a moustache?). Overall, rather disappointing. 2 STARS So there you have it, I hope that saves you the time I lost as well as the money I spent! Review: Great for laughs and suburb examples/ideas - What talent! Good for intermediate to advanced carvers
The first 20 pages show caricatures from expert carvers and they are really well done! Following those 20 pages are 50 really cool carvings with patterns. This book has a few tips for each pattern but no actual instruction so it is a better buy if you are an intermediate carver wanting to challenge him/herself or and expert carver looking for patterns. I suspect that a carver who is capable of carving these would also be making up his/her own patterns. Anyway, I like it and am excited to try to duplicate some of these patterns.
